...
Menu
Build with us

Design Systems: Streamlining Consistency in UI/UX Design

BLOG

In the realm of user experience (UX) and user interface (UI) design, maintaining consistency is a cornerstone of creating cohesive and user-friendly digital experiences. Enter design systems – a strategic approach that streamlines the design process, fosters character, and empowers teams to deliver high-quality interfaces. This article delves into the concept of design systems, their components, their benefits, and how they revolutionize the design world.

Understanding Design Systems

A design system is a collection of guidelines, principles, and reusable components that standardize the design and development process across an organization. It provides a unified language for designers, developers, and stakeholders, ensuring that the final product maintains a consistent look, feel, and behavior.

Components of a Design System

A robust design system encompasses several key components:

  • Typography Guidelines: Define font choices, sizes, line heights, and spacing to ensure a consistent text hierarchy.
  • Color Palette: Establish a set of colors and their usage guidelines to maintain visual harmony.
  • Iconography: Standardize icons to convey meaning and visual cues consistently.
  • Components and Patterns: Create a library of reusable UI components (buttons, forms, cards) and design patterns (navigation, grids) to expedite development.
  • Spacing and Layout: Set spacing, margins, and layout grids rules to ensure interface alignment.

Benefits of Design Systems

Design systems offer a host of benefits to both design teams and organizations as a whole:

  • Consistency: Design systems ensure a unified visual language, fostering a seamless user experience across products and platforms.
  • Efficiency: Reusable components and patterns accelerate design and development, saving time and resources.
  • Scalability: Design systems adapt as projects grow, ensuring consistency isn’t compromised.
  • Collaboration: Cross-functional teams can collaborate more effectively, as everyone follows the same guidelines.
  • Brand Cohesion: Design systems maintain brand integrity by providing clear rules for brand elements.

Creating and Maintaining a Design System

Developing a design system involves collaboration, iteration, and ongoing maintenance:

  1. Research and Audit: Understand existing design elements and identify inconsistencies that need addressing.
  2. Component Library: Develop a library of UI components, considering modularity and reusability.
  3. Guidelines and Documentation: Document design principles, rules, and usage guidelines for each component.
  4. Implementation: Ensure design system components are implemented consistently across projects.
  5. Continuous Improvement: Regularly update the design system to accommodate new needs and technologies.

Collaboration between Designers and Developers

Design systems foster collaboration between designers and developers by providing a shared framework. Designers contribute the visual and interactive guidelines, while developers implement these guidelines in code. Clear communication and an iterative feedback loop enhance the quality of the final product.

Extending Design Systems for Multiple Platforms

Design systems are adaptable across various web, mobile, and print platforms. While specific considerations might vary, the core design principles and guidelines remain consistent.

Case Studies: Successful Implementations of Design Systems

Several companies have embraced design systems to create consistent and user-friendly interfaces:

  • Google’s Material Design: A comprehensive design system that influences the look and feel of Google’s products across platforms.
  • Airbnb’s Design Language System: A scalable design system that ensures consistency while allowing customization for different teams and regions.

Conclusion

Design systems are more than just style guides; they are the backbone of modern design and development workflows. By establishing consistent guidelines, reusable components, and a unified visual language, design systems empower teams to create interfaces that are aesthetically pleasing but also intuitive and user-centric. As design systems evolve and adapt to new technologies and trends, they remain invaluable for ensuring cohesive and exceptional digital experiences.

admin

admin@linesandpixels.team
Explore more Blogs

Ready to Transform Your Online Presence?

Elevate your business with a custom-designed website that captivates and converts. Let our expert team craft a digital experience perfectly tailored to your brand's needs.
BUILD WITH US
Seraphinite AcceleratorOptimized by Seraphinite Accelerator
Turns on site high speed to be attractive for people and search engines.